Form 3 regulatory
"filed an initial statement of beneficial ownership (Form 3) for Eldad Yaron"
Form 3 is the initial public filing that officers, directors and large shareholders must submit to report their ownership of a company’s securities when they become insiders. It acts like an opening inventory sheet that gives investors a starting point to see who holds significant stakes and to spot later trades or potential conflicts of interest, helping assess insider confidence and transparency.
initial statement of beneficial ownership regulatory
"filed an initial statement of beneficial ownership (Form 3) for Eldad Yaron"
An initial statement of beneficial ownership is the first regulatory filing an insider or large investor submits to disclose the amount of a company's stock they control or benefit from. It matters to investors because it reveals who has significant influence over a company—like showing who’s holding the cards—and helps track potential conflicts of interest, insider motives, and future buying or selling that can move the stock price.
Power of Attorney regulatory
"A power of attorney is referenced as an exhibit"
A power of attorney is a legal document that allows one person to make decisions and act on behalf of another person, often in financial or legal matters. It’s like giving someone a trusted helper or agent the authority to handle important tasks if you are unable to do so yourself. This matters to investors because it can impact how their assets are managed or transferred if they become unable to oversee their affairs.
